The Good Beer Year Book is a must-read for anyone interested in beer, brewing and more in the UK.With entries curated by leading beer writer Emma Inch,The Good Beer Year Bookis a round-up of all of the current news, stories, events, awards, festivals and more from 2022.This Book is also looking at innovations, influencers and the people to look out for in the months ahead.With articles coveringTop 10 beers of the yearAlco-free and 'functional beers' - what's the future? - Pete BrownMilds - not just for May - Matthew CurtisReckoning in the industry - Melissa ColeColour bar a racial segregation - David JesudasonSustainability - the move to carbon Zero - Hollie StephensWhy pubs are the best places to drink - Jess Masonand more from, Jonny Garrett, Jane Peyton, Laura Hadland, Adrian Tierney-Jones, Roger Protz, Tim Webb, Andy-Parker.
